George R.R. Martin Producing New Hercules Film, Winds of Winter Delayed?

Acclaimed Game of Thrones author George R.R. Martin has signed on as producer for an upcoming animated Hercules film, marking another creative endeavor outside his unfinished book series. This news comes as fans continue waiting for The Winds of Winter, the next installment in his A Song of Ice and Fire saga.
A Mythological Reimagining
The Hollywood Reporter reveals Martin will produce this fresh adaptation of Hercules' legendary Twelve Labors. Titled A Dozen Tough Jobs, the animated feature will retell the Greek myth through the eyes of a 1920s Mississippi farmer - blending ancient heroism with American Depression-era struggles.
Interestingly, while Martin oversees production, the screenplay falls to Joe R. Lansdale, the cult author behind bizarre tales like Bubba Ho-Tep (which pitted Elvis against an Egyptian mummy).
"George R.R. Martin understands epic storytelling better than anyone," said David Steward II of Lion Forge Entertainment. "This isn't just another mythology reboot - we're delivering an unprecedented interpretation that grounds these myths in historical reality while expanding their narrative possibilities."
The Long Wait Continues
Meanwhile, the fantasy author's devoted readers remain in limbo regarding his literary masterpiece. It's been nearly 14 years since the last A Song of Ice and Fire novel, A Dance with Dragons (2011), with no confirmed release date for The Winds of Winter.
Though Martin maintains plans to conclude the series with A Dream of Spring, his recent blog update offered little hope for impatient fans: "Television commitments consumed most of 2024," he wrote, adding that false rumors about imminent releases frustrate him.
Martin continues expanding his creative portfolio through HBO's Game of Thrones prequel House of the Dragon, Westeros-inspired historical fiction, and even video game collaborations like his worldbuilding contributions to Elden Ring.
